About the Club

United Athletic Club is Portland's premier fitness facility. Our facility is equipped with free weights, machines, and cardio equipment to suit a variety of training styles. If you're searching for more direction and accountability with your training, United Athletic Club also offers results-driven personal training to help you reach your health and fitness goals. We are a supportive, community-based gym and we welcome all ability levels and walks of life.

Kamryn Ruthardt

★ 3

Lots of machine variety and affordable membership is a plus. But while they do have 2 deadlift platforms and some squat racks which is nice, they are unfortunately lacking accessibility to enough weight plates local to the areas. So for anyone who is a serious lifter, expect to drag plates from all over the gym and steal them off other machines to get your workout done. This isn't a dig on the gym itself, but just my warning to people who enjoy lifting heavy or training for any powerlifting may want to look into other gyms. There is also only one flat bench which is odd for a gym of this size. The potential for this gym to be great for all training types is there, as they just need more weighted plates for the racks and deadlift platforms.

(edit for response) yes there are a few 25kg bumper plates on one side of platform in first room and other side is an independent squat rack with standard weight plates up to 45lb from what I remember, so if someone is squatting there, you would be taking their plates. I also found myself needing to take plates from Smith machine next to the multi squat racks if squatting due to only a small mixture of bumper plates being placed in front of the racks.
